Then Solomon went to Ezion-Geber and to Eloth upon the lip of the sea in the land of Edom. And Huram will send to him by the hand of his servants, ships, and servants knowing the sea; and they will go with the servants of Solomon to Ophir, and they will take from there four hundred and fifty talents of gold and bring to king Solomon.

And the weight of the gold that came to Solomon in one year will be six hundred and sixty six talents of gold; Besides from men reconnoitering and those trafficking, bringing. And all the kings of Arabia and the prefects of the land bringing gold and silver to Solomon. And king Solomon will make two hundred shields of beaten gold: six hundred of beaten gold he will bring up upon one shield. read more.
And three hundred shields of beaten sold: three hundred of gold he will bring up upon one shield. And the king will give them into the house of the forest of Lebanon. And the king will make a great throne of ivory, and he will overlay it with pure gold. And six steps to the throne, and a footstool in gold holding fast to the throne, and hands from hence and from thence, upon the place of the seat, and two lions standing near the hands. And twelve lions standing there upon the six steps, from hence and from thence. There was not made thus to any kingdom.
